Output d895b9506e764c28c86a349c29326dc098270eef77d16537cf4e6e1239610a86:2

value
2692700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e496246fd6abdc98d9f800999f5e4fd5472cd619 OP_EQUAL
address
3NXfrMSKNpbNAdjbswubQThidoNNsNJrhE
transaction
d895b9506e764c28c86a349c29326dc098270eef77d16537cf4e6e1239610a86
spent
true